Executive Synthesis
Bull Case Preview
Perma-Pipe International Holdings is positioning itself as a primary beneficiary of the global energy transition and U.S. infrastructure modernization. The company reported a 7.5% increase in net sales to $50.3 million for the quarter ended April 30, 2026, with a notable 12% surge in its specialty piping and coating segment. This growth is underpinned by a robust $110.7 million backlog and a strategic expansion of its manufacturing footprint, including a new facility in Ohio and a joint venture in Qatar. The company's ability to secure long-term financing and maintain a strong cash position of $28.3 million suggests a management team focused on sustainable scaling. ... (continues in full analysis)
Bear Case Preview
Despite top-line growth, Perma-Pipe's latest filing reveals a concerning trend of margin erosion and financial fragility. Gross margins plummeted to 29% from 35.7% a year ago, as the cost of sales grew significantly faster than revenue. This operational struggle is compounded by a heavy debt load, including a $18 million revolving credit facility and a $2.75 million promissory note that has already passed its maturity date. The company's reliance on a borrowing base tied to accounts receivable creates a precarious liquidity loop, where any delay in customer payments could trigger a credit crunch. ...
